Keibunsha A Link to the Past Strategy Guide
Games | ||
Cost | ¥580 (yen) (List Price) | |
Release Date | January 15th, 1992 | |
Credits | ||
---|---|---|
Publisher | ||
Attributes | ||
Type | ||
Language | Japanese | |
Length | 96 Pages | |
ISBN | 4-7669-0742-6 |
Features
- First 64 pages are in full color, with the remainder of the guide in black and white
- Includes a listing of all of Link's items, including descriptions and official artwork
- Small section dedicated to the controls, with artwork of Link performing various poses
- Large maps of the dungeons, complete with a listing of what enemies are encountered in each dungeon
- Small, hand-drawn maps of the various caves and certain Overworld areas
- Some official artwork of the various enemies and bosses found throughout the guide
- Full guide through the Swamp Palace. For Skull Woods, Blind's Hideout, Ice Palace, and Misery Mire, only small, brief tips
- No guide for Turtle Rock, Ganon's Tower, or the final boss
- 10+ pages at the end of the guide dedicated to frequently asked questions and answers
